• 2527 Lowbit(N)

    Time Limit : 2000/1000 MS(Java/Others) | Memory Limit : 65536/32768 KB(Java/Others)

    Submits : 160 | Solved : 79

    Description

    听说过树状数组吗?树状数组中的Lowbit是提高效率的关键。

    Lowbit(N)N的二进制表示中最低位的1所表示的数。

    N = 14 = 11102),所以A最低位的1所表示的数为10,结果为2


    Input

    每行输入一个数NEOF结束。

    测试数据不超过1000个。


    Output

    输出Lowbit(N)


    Sample Input

    1
    14
    12
    

    Sample Output

    1
    2
    4
    

    HINT


    Source

    NBU xuenene


    [ Top ] | [ Submit ] | [ Statistics ] | [ Standing ]